PKL 12: UP Yoddhas vs Bengal Warriorz prediction, possible starting 7, head-to-head & free live stream

Both teams will be looking for their first win in the Jaipur leg.
Pro Kabaddi League Season 12 (PKL 12) has been spectacular with many closely fought encounters. Tuesday promises to be another exciting day as Bengal Warriorz will face UP Yoddhas. Both teams have a young raiding Unit and will look to dominate against the experienced defenders.
Bengal had a tough loss against Tamil Thalaivas. Thalaivas had a set plan against Devank Dalal, who struggled against Ronak, the right cover defender.
For Yoddhas, they were blown away by the raiding duo of Nitin Dhankar and Ali Choubtarash. It will be an interesting game as both teams will be coming out rectifying their old mistakes.

UP Yoddhas vs Bengal Warriorz head-to-head:
- Matches: 16
- UP Yoddhas: 6
- Bengal Warriorz: 4
- Tie: 6
These two sides have played the most tied games against each other in PKL history.
Players to watch out for
UP Yoddhas – Ashu Singh
Ashu Singh has been one of the investments of UP Yoddhas. He has been with the franchise for six seasons. Despite scoring no points in the previous game, he will feature in the playing seven and will look to tackle Devank Dalal.
The right cover defender would capitalise on his recent struggle. It will be a payback of sorts as both fought hard last year.
Bengal Warriorz – Nitesh Kumar
Nitesh Kumar was left out of the game against Tamil Thalaivas, but he is likely to play against the Yoddhas. The right corner defender was synonymous with the Yoddhas for six seasons since its inception.
He knows the style of play adopted by them and will be key to tackling the opposition and the raiders on the day of the game.
